Understanding the technical superiority of T-Series glass

Mobile cinematography has reached a professional plateau in 2026, and the Moment T-Series Anamorphic Lens (1.33x Blue Flare) stands as the primary reason for this shift. While the older M-Series lenses are still circulating within Oceania and Southeast Asian marketplaces, they are largely incompatible with the larger sensors found in the latest smartphone iterations. The T-Series features a significantly larger bayonet mount, which prevents vignetting and ensures edge-to-edge clarity that regional alternatives cannot match.

The 1.33x squeeze factor provides that classic 2.40:1 Cinemascope aspect ratio, while the specific Blue Flare coating delivers the iconic horizontal streaks associated with high-end Hollywood productions. Managing logistics and shipping expectations

Providing accurate data for your freight forwarder is essential for a smooth delivery experience. The Moment T-Series lens is a precision instrument but remains a compact item in terms of cargo volume. Below are the estimated logistics specifications for this item:

Metric Estimate
Box Weight Approx. 0.45 kg (1.0 lb) including retail packaging and protective mailer.
Box Dimensions Small (Approx. 15cm x 10cm x 8cm).
Volumetric Warning Low. This item is dense and compact; volumetric weight will likely not exceed actual weight.
Battery Check None. This is a purely optical glass component and contains no lithium batteries.
